Abstract

The invention discloses a method for identifying commodity information based on NFC (Near Field Communication), which comprises the following steps: sending an instruction for inquiring a radio frequency label by a NFC terminal, wherein the instruction comprises a to-be-inquired commodity category; reading anti-fake information by the radio frequency label according to the commodity category, wherein the anti-fake information comprises a commodity information dynamic code, an access times information code, a UID (User Identifier) number, a CPU (Central Processing Unit) operation code and a random code; after encrypting the anti-fake information by the radio frequency label, sending to a cloud computing server by the NFC terminal; and decrypting the encrypted anti-fake information by the cloud computing server, comparing the decrypted anti-fake information with the locally stored anti-fake information, judging the truth of the radio frequency label and informing the NFC terminal. According to the method provided by the invention, the anti-fake information is dynamically generated and is difficult to copy, so that the safety in anti-fake check is increased.

Embodiment
A kind of merchandise news recognition system based on NFC of the embodiment of the invention 1 as shown in Figure 1, comprises cloud computing server 10, NFC terminal 20 and radio-frequency (RF) tag 30.NFC terminal 20 sends the request of a certain class merchandise query to radio-frequency (RF) tag 30, and the anti-counterfeiting information that radio-frequency (RF) tag 30 is encrypted sends to cloud computing server 10; Radio-frequency (RF) tag 30 receives the merchandise query request that NFC terminal 20 sends, read anti-counterfeiting information according to described merchandise classification, described anti-counterfeiting information comprises merchandise news dynamic code, access times information code, UID number, central processing unit CPU operation part and random code, sends to NFC terminal 20 after will described anti-counterfeiting information encrypting; After the anti-counterfeiting information of 10 pairs of above-mentioned encryptions of cloud computing server is decrypted, the anti-counterfeiting information of the anti-counterfeiting information after the deciphering with local storage compared, judge the true and false of this radio-frequency (RF) tag, with final judged result notice NFC terminal 20.In addition, cloud computing server 10 be used for to determine that also radio-frequency (RF) tag is true time, after dynamically generating new anti-counterfeiting information and encrypting, returns to radio-frequency (RF) tag 30; Radio-frequency (RF) tag 30 deciphering obtain described new anti-counterfeiting information, and storage.
Wherein, NFC terminal 20 adopts contactless identification and interconnection technique, can carry out wireless near field communication at mobile device, consumer electronics product and smart control Tool Room, a kind of solution of simple, touch is provided, can have allowed consumer's simple, intuitive ground exchange message, accessed content and service.Because NFC has taked unique signal attenuation technique, have the characteristics such as near distance, bandwidth is high, energy consumption is low.Secondly, NFC and existing contactless smart card technical compatibility have become the official standard that obtains the support of more and more leading firms at present.Again, NFC or a kind of closely connection protocol provide between various device easily, safety, rapidly and automatically communication.
Radio-frequency (RF) tag 30 as shown in Figure 2, comprise: antenna, radio-frequency module, CPU(Central Processing Unit, CPU (central processing unit)), ROM(Read-Only Memory, ROM (read-only memory)), RAM(Random Access Memory, random access memory), EEPROM(Electrically Erasable Programmable Read-Only Memory, EEPROM (Electrically Erasable Programmable Read Only Memo)) etc.CPU is connected with ROM, RAM, EEPROM and radio-frequency module, communicates control; Radio-frequency module is communicated by letter with NFC terminal 20 by antenna.Wherein, the anti-counterfeiting information of storing among the EEPROM comprises: UID(User Identification, user identity proves) number, for read-only; The merchandise news dynamic code through generating after cloud computing server 10 encryptions, is provided new number by cloud computing server 10 after reading at every turn, again deposits in; The access times information code is the serial number that increases progressively behind each access cloud computing server, such as 1,2,3 ...., n, and with serial number through encrypting, generate the access times information code; The CPU operation part for part key code in the CPU operation program, is dynamically provided by cloud computing server at every turn; Random code is dynamically provided by cloud computing server at every turn.During each read operation, CPU carries out computing with above related data and encrypts according to the order of ROM Program, sends to cloud computing server 10 by NFC terminal 20.Radio-frequency (RF) tag 30 is installed on the open place of commodity usually, and when commodity are enabled, radio-frequency (RF) tag 30 will be destroyed.Cloud computing server 10 is also preserved UID and the merchandise news of radio-frequency (RF) tag 30 storages
A kind of merchandise news recognition methods based on NFC of the embodiment of the invention 2 as shown in Figure 3, may further comprise the steps:
Step 101, described NFC terminal sends the instruction of inquiry radio-frequency (RF) tag, comprises the merchandise classification of needs inquiry in this instruction.
Step 102, described radio-frequency (RF) tag reads anti-counterfeiting information in the program information, EEPROM of ROM according to described merchandise classification, the anti-counterfeiting information that reads comprises: the UID of radio-frequency (RF) tag, merchandise news dynamic code, access times information code, CPU operation part and random code.Wherein, the access times information code is for after this radio-frequency (RF) tag dispatches from the factory, and every access once, access times record in the cloud computing server increases progressively, behind special cryptographic calculation, obtain access times information, and naturally 1,2,3 ..., n is corresponding one by one, but through cryptographic calculation; The CPU operation part is part key code in the CPU operation program, comprises specifying the code that reads some character among the radio-frequency (RF) tag UID, is regenerated by cloud computing server after reading at every turn.
Step 103, the CPU in the radio-frequency (RF) tag sends to the NFC terminal after the anti-counterfeiting information that reads is encrypted.
Step 104, the anti-counterfeiting information that the NFC terminal will be encrypted sends to cloud computing server.
Step 105, cloud computing server is decrypted the anti-counterfeiting information of the encryption that receives, obtains merchandise news dynamic code, access times information code, UID number, CPU operation part and random code.Automatically record simultaneously the IP address of each access, according to the false pain product of differentiating, according to the IP address, can trace the fraud root.
Step 106, cloud computing server compares by the anti-counterfeiting information anti-counterfeiting information corresponding with this radio-frequency (RF) tag of storage that above-mentioned deciphering obtains, and judges the true and false of this radio-frequency (RF) tag, if be false, then notify the NFC terminal, show that in the NFC terminal testing result is false; If access times are 2, then show that in the NFC terminal testing result is true; If access times are 1, then turn 107.
Judge that the true and false specifically comprises: CPU operation part (COS that deposits among the ROM) structured data by the NFC terminal transmits judges whether to be tampered, if be tampered then be false; In addition, can also judge according to the access times information code true and false of radio-frequency (RF) tag, because after the anti-counterfeiting information that at every turn reads radio-frequency (RF) tag passes to cloud computing server, access times should add one, if the access times of the access times of radio-frequency (RF) tag and cloud computing server record are not inconsistent, it is false then differentiating radio-frequency (RF) tag.In addition, certain lot number data connected reference n time all after the mistake, suspends the access of this radio-frequency (RF) tag, and replys to communication apparatus: " please contacting with producer ".In addition, judges radio-frequency (RF) tag when first checking and as after very, if the sequence number that sequence number is stored less than cloud computing server appears in subsequent authentication, judge that then this radio-frequency (RF) tag is vacation.
Step 107, cloud computing server through different cryptographic algorithm, generates new following data according to the classified information that receives: the merchandise news dynamic code that re-encrypted generates; The access times information code (this information is the serial number that increases progressively behind each access server, such as 1,2,3 ...., n ..., and with serial number through encrypting, generate new access times information code; (part key code in the CPU operation program comprises and specifies the code that reads some character among the radio-frequency (RF) tag UID CPU operation part, is regenerated by cloud computing server after reading at every turn; Random code (is dynamically provided by cloud computing server at every turn, by cloud computing server is regenerated after reading at every turn.Cloud computing server storage anti-counterfeiting information is also encrypted the generated data bag, sends to the NFC terminal;
Step 108, the NFC terminal sends to radio-frequency (RF) tag with encrypted packets;
Step 109, radio-frequency (RF) tag deciphering anti-counterfeiting information, store this anti-counterfeiting information after, encrypt generated data bag (comprising new anti-counterfeiting information), store among the EEPROM.
After an above-mentioned query script is finished, can proceed repeatedly to inquire about, if but after successfully inquiring about n time continuously, suspend a period of time access; If after inquiring about unsuccessfully n time continuously, prompt for vacation, stop the verification of data of this label, record the IP of all abuses, visit again later on, do not show the result, record IP.
